Product Information

Fandex celebrates the plays, the plots, the poetry--and obsession, conspiracy, madness, sorcery, murder, yearning and bloodshed. A chronology from The First Part of Henry VI, with its detailed staging of warfare, to the sublime allegory of The Tempest, here is the hesitation of Hamlet. The absolute evil of Iago. Macbeth's ambition, Lear's blind pride, Falstaff's Mockery, Juliet's passion. Illustrated with a fascinating mix of historic paintings and photographs of actors in their definitive roles, SHAKESPEARE puts the Bard and his every play in the palm of your hand. 50 INDIVIDUALLY DIE-CUT CARDS FULL COLOR THROUGHOUT KNOWLEDGE AT YOUR FINGERTIPS FOR THE WHOLE FAMILY
